YUM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2023 in Review
1,213 of the 6,859 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Yum! Brands (YUM) for Q4 2023, worth a combined $30.6B — up 8.6% from $28.2B a quarter earlier.
Buyers outnumbered sellers: 177 funds opened new YUM positions and 72 closed out — a net gain of 105 holders — while 381 added to existing stakes and 398 trimmed.
The largest buyer was Morgan Stanley, adding an estimated $439M. The largest seller was D1 Capital Partners, exiting entirely with an estimated $112M sold.
